I replaced the fuel pressure regulator and it still has a problem starting. I have to turn the key over awhile before it catches. Like fuel isn't getting all the way up. When I drive there are no problems. After driving awhile it will start right up , but if it sits up awhile it takes time to start. What needs to be done ? It could be a weak Fuel Pump and or a bad FPR.

Try this next time...

Turn key to on possition without starting then back off. do this 2 or 3 times then try starting. If starts up replace FPR.
